The Digital Transformation of ⁢Gambling Platforms

The gambling​ industry is undergoing a seismic shift, driven largely ​by the rapid advancement of technology. The digital landscape has not only expanded the reach of gambling platforms but has also enhanced user experience. Players can now ⁣access an array of gaming options from the comfort of their homes or on the go, ‍thanks to mobile⁢ applications and responsive websites. This convenience is complemented by the incorporation⁣ of live dealer ⁤games, which replicate the atmosphere of a traditional casino, allowing users to​ interact with real dealers in real-time.⁣ Additionally, the integration ‌of artificial intelligence and machine learning is reshaping user engagement by personalizing game recommendations based on individual preferences and playing patterns.

Furthermore, blockchain technology has emerged as a powerful tool for ensuring ⁣transparency and security⁢ within online gambling. By utilizing decentralized ledgers, platforms can provide a level of accountability previously unseen in‌ the industry. ​This fosters greater trust among ‍users, as they can verify transactions without the need for an intermediary. Beyond security, virtual⁣ re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) technologies ‌are poised‌ to revolutionize online gambling, offering immersive experiences ​that mimic physical environments in thrilling new ways. The adoption ​of these technologies is set to blur​ the lines ⁣between digital and physical gambling spaces, creating a more integrated gaming ecosystem.

Data-Driven Decisions:⁣ The Role of Analytics in Betting

The integration of analytics into the betting ⁤landscape has transformed how enthusiasts‌ engage with their favorite sports and events. With vast amounts​ of​ data available at our fingertips, bettors can now harness advanced analytics ‍to make informed wagers. This data-centric‌ approach brings several advantages:

  • Enhanced Predictive Models: Using historical data to forecast ⁤outcomes, bettors can refine⁢ their ‌strategies.
  • Real-Time ‍Insights: Live statistics ⁢and trends allow for adjustments mid-game, increasing opportunities for winning‌ bets.
  • Risk Management: ‍ Analytical tools help evaluate risk levels,⁢ aiding in responsible ‌gambling practices.

Online platforms have begun ⁢to incorporate machine learning techniques to analyse player performance,⁤ team statistics, and even weather ⁢conditions, providing deeper ‍insights into the mechanics of betting. One innovative implementation ​is the use ​of machine learning algorithms that can learn ⁢from past outcomes and adapt accordingly, enabling bettors to unlock patterns‍ that would otherwise remain⁣ hidden. The table below illustrates the key factors that contemporary analytical systems consider:

Factor Description
Player Performance Statistical ‍analysis of individual athletes for more accurate assessments.
Historical Data Review of ⁤past matches to identify trends and anomalies.
Environmental Factors Impact of weather and field conditions on game outcomes.

Responsible Gambling in the Age of Automation

In an era where technology reshapes our everyday experiences, the gambling⁣ industry is no ‌exception. As automation and sophisticated algorithms streamline operations and enhance user engagement, it becomes paramount to prioritize player safety and well-being. Stakeholders, from operators to regulators, must foster an environment⁢ where responsible gambling is seamlessly integrated into the ⁤digital landscape. Here are some key strategies that underscore the necessity of such integration:

  • Personalized Limits: Utilizing​ data analysis to⁣ establish customized betting limits based on player‍ behavior and history.
  • Real-time‍ Monitoring: Implementing AI-driven tools that can identify risky patterns or⁤ anomalies in gambling behavior.
  • Player Education: Providing resources ​and information on responsible gambling practices through automated platforms, making them easily accessible.

Moreover, the rise of automation brings forth⁤ challenges that demand an urgent response.⁣ The ease of access and 24/7 availability of online gambling platforms can ⁢blur the lines of responsible play. Thus, a balanced approach is needed, ensuring ⁢that technology enhances⁤ the gambling experience while ‌mitigating its​ potential risks. Key​ elements that can ‍help ⁣shape a more secure‍ gaming environment include:

Element Description
Self-Exclusion Tools Options allowing players to restrict their ⁢access to‍ gambling⁣ platforms for set ‍periods.
AI Chatbots Use of virtual assistants to provide instant support ⁣on responsible gambling resources.
Gamification of Responsibility Incorporating engaging elements‍ to encourage responsible gaming habits among players.
